Who Was Casimir Pulaski?

Casimir Pulaski was a Polish military leader who later became an important figure in the American fight for independence. He was born in 1745 in Poland and was known for his bravery and strong belief in freedom.

Pulaski first fought for liberty in his own country. However, political struggles forced him to leave Poland. After leaving Europe, he decided to support the American cause for independence.

When Pulaski arrived in America in 1777, he offered his military experience to help the Continental Army. His dedication and courage quickly impressed American leaders.

Because of his contributions, Pulaski later became known as the “Father of the American Cavalry.”

The Origin of the Famous Quote

The Casimir Pulaski quote comes from a letter he wrote after arriving in America. In that message, he clearly expressed his purpose for coming to the new land.

He wrote that he had come to a place where freedom was being defended and that he was ready to serve the cause and even give his life for it.

These words show how deeply Pulaski believed in the idea of liberty. Even though he was not born in America, he believed strongly in the fight for freedom.

Pulaski’s Role in the American Revolution

Pulaski played an important role in the American Revolutionary War. His military skills helped strengthen the Continental Army.

One of his most famous moments came during the Battle of Brandywine in 1777. Pulaski led a brave cavalry charge that helped protect the American forces during the battle.

Because of his leadership and courage, he was appointed a brigadier general. He later formed a special military unit known as the Pulaski Legion.

This unit combined cavalry and infantry soldiers and played a major role in several military operations during the war.

Why Pulaski Is Remembered Today

The Casimir Pulaski quote continues to keep his legacy alive, but there are many other reasons he is remembered.

Today, many places in the United States honor his name. Streets, schools, and monuments have been named after him.

Every year, General Pulaski Memorial Day is also observed to recognize his sacrifice and bravery.
